Grand Rapids looked good. Very steady team, not many mistakes and good goalie. Burnsville made a run for it at the end and had GR on their heels. Very fun game to watch. Rapids scored a couple of easy goals to get ahead 4-1.
OMG looked like they were skating in quicksand. Not what I expected from them. EGF got a gift on their first goal and 2nd goal was nice! Hung on to beat a charging, but too late, team from Osseo Maple Grove. Surprise game of the day! Usually one of those in the state tournament.
Woodbury took a while against Cloquet. Cloquet was up 3-2 after 2 periods, but looked beat. Cloquet plays #7, #11, #15 and #10 all of the time. They looked gas and Woodbury dominated play from 2nd period on. Woodbury scored late power play goal and an empty netter to win 5-3.
Wayzata looked very good and convincing in their win over Elk River. Will have to play Woodbury tomorrow in semis. Will be a very good game!!
Very entertaining first day of action. Only prediction that was wrong was EGF over OMG. EGF played well and deserved the win!
I still see Grand Rapids versus Woodbury in the finals. Woodbury has beaten Wayzata twice this year, but that doesn't matter anymore. One game takes it all and gives two of the teams a chance to play for the Bantam A State Tournament Championship!!
